Just off the top of my head, I'm thinking your security settings are wiping out the cookies we place to remember your password & keep you logged in after you've entered your password on the login page. The idea behind checking the Remember Me is so you allow this site to install cookies to keep your password & keep you logged in. But if your browser security setting are set too high, that negates the Remember Me function.

The PW the site generates via the Lost Passwords procedure is only good for a set time, then it expires. I don't know if it's half an hour, an hour or 24 hours. But I do know it's only meant for granting one time access & then you are to change it to a permanent password via the link under the User CP tab.
